The Dutch Two Tier Rack was developed by Jan Kuiper s in 1929; the company was the first to design a double tier system with gas assisted movable upper sections. Today their two tier racks have been installed in over 180,000 places at a wide variety of locations throughout Europe.
Its space saving, robust design doubles the amount of cycle parking compared with traditional cycle rack and its gas assisted mechanism increases its usability. The Dutch Two Tier Rack is ideal for high density areas, and can be installed at train stations, offices, schools and shopping centres and major transport hubs.
Features
Movable upper gutter.
Gas assisted lifting mechanism for ease of use
